What Are Robot Hoover and Mop Systems?

Robot hoover and mop systems are autonomous cleaning gadgets created to preserve the tidiness of floors in homes and offices. These robots are geared up with advanced sensors, mapping innovation, and AI algorithms that allow them to navigate through spaces, identify dirt and barriers, and tidy effectively without human intervention. The hoover component is accountable for vacuuming dust, dirt, and debris, while the mop part is entrusted with wet cleaning and polishing hard surface areas.

Secret Features and Functions

Autonomous Navigation

  • Mapping and Planning: Modern robot hoover and mop systems utilize LiDAR (Light Detection and Ranging) or visual navigation systems to create a map of the environment. This allows them to strategy efficient cleaning paths and prevent challenges.
  • Smart Obstacle Detection: Advanced sensors help the robot spot and navigate around furnishings, animals, and other barriers, making sure that it doesn't get stuck or cause damage.

Multi-Surface Cleaning

  • Versatility: These robotics can clean a variety of surfaces, consisting of wood, tile, and carpet. Some designs are even developed to transition perfectly between various kinds of flooring.
  • Adjustable Water Flow: For the mopping function, adjustable water circulation settings guarantee that the correct amount of wetness is utilized on different surface areas to prevent water damage.

Adjustable Cleaning Schedules

  • Timed Cleaning: Users can set particular times for the robot to start cleaning, enabling a consistent and foreseeable cleaning schedule.
  • Push-button control: Most robots can be controlled through a smart device app, enabling users to start, stop, or schedule cleaning sessions from anywhere.

Efficient Dirt and Dust Removal

  • Top quality Filters: Many models come with HEPA filters that capture great dust and allergens, making them ideal for homes with allergic reactions.
  • Strong Suction: Powerful motors provide strong suction to raise and remove ingrained dirt and debris from floorings.

Upkeep and Convenience

  • Self-Emptying Bins: Some advanced models include self-emptying bins, lowering the requirement for frequent manual upkeep.
  • Auto-Return to Charging Station: When the battery is low, the robot immediately returns to its charging station, ensuring it is always prepared for the next cleaning session.

Combination with Smart Home Devices

  • Voice Control: Compatibility with smart home assistants like Amazon Alexa and Google Assistant permits voice-activated cleaning.
  • Home Security: Some models can be geared up with cameras and motion sensing units, doubling as security gadgets while they clean up.

Prospective Drawbacks

Cost

  • Initial Investment: While the long-lasting cost savings on manual cleaning appear, the upfront expense of a robot hoover and mop system can be considerable.

Maintenance

  • Regular Cleaning: The brushes, filters, and mopping fabrics need to be cleaned routinely to ensure optimum performance.
  • Battery Life: Like all battery-operated gadgets, the robot's battery needs routine charging and replacement.

Restricted Cleaning Capabilities

  • Stairs and High Surfaces: Most robots are not designed to tidy stairs or high surface areas like counter tops.
  • Heavy Dirt and Messes: For serious dirt and spills, manual cleaning may still be necessary.

Frequently asked questions

Q: How frequently should I clean my robot hoover and mop?

  • A: It's recommended to clean up the brushes, filters, and mopping cloths after every 3-5 cleaning sessions to make sure ideal efficiency.

Q: Can these robots clean stairs?

  • A: No, a lot of robot hoover and mop systems are designed to tidy flat surfaces and can not navigate stairs.

Q: Are they appropriate for homes with family pets?

  • A: Yes, lots of models are equipped with pet hair cleaning functions and can manage the additional dirt and hair that pets bring into the home.

Q: How long do the batteries last?

  • A: Battery life differs by model, but a lot of robotics can clean for 90-120 minutes before requiring a recharge.

Q: Can I control the robot with my voice?

  • A: Yes, numerous models work with smart home assistants like Amazon Alexa and Google Assistant, enabling voice-activated control.
